Installed x2mr2 (side by side with x2mr1), now posts zero for spindle speed. It worked fine on x2 mr1 sp1. The machine definition, control definition looks correct (redid for changed post for coolant values (edited mpmaster)) Even tried posting with old post, so it's not the post editing).

 

Any ideas? running on mr1 until i can figure out.

Try posting out using another MD/CD/Post set (e.g. DEFAULT MILL.MMD) What do you get now?

If you now get something other than '0', we know the issue lies in your MD/CD/Post setup.

If that is the case, I would first check the MD as it is the easiest to do...

Open your MD (Machine Definition) in the Machine Definition Manager. In the the Machine Configuration (lower-right corner of the dialog), expand all the items in the Mill Spindle Group. Right click on the Tool Spindle item and select Properties. What are the Min/Max Spindle Speed settings? If those look good, this issue is probably in your PST.

Posting with mill.mmd it does post out the spindle speed. I went through the md before and lowered the max to 15000. I double checked and it is still set correctly. can the md/cd get corrupted and still open? I also retried again posting using the post that works correctly in x2 mr1 sp1, and post out 0 for spindle.
